As important as the production budget and the actual video shoot, is the selection of the post production company who will take your raw footage and craft it into your final, finished project for delivery.
In some cases, you'll have a long-standing relationship with a tried and trusted post house, but if not or if you're shooting in a different location or country, how do you know which is the right one for you and your project?
Here we take you through the factors to consider when deciding on your next post production company.
What Do You Actually Need to Choose a Post House?
Different productions will have different requirements and there are quite distinct needs in each genre. If you're making a factual programme you'll most likely need quick access to archive footage and good sound suites to adjust audio levels in interviews and voice-overs. If reality is your focus, your concerns will be on the offline capabilities, rather than online, and having large storage availability. And if it's drama, you'll need intensive colour grading and a graphics department all these things and so much more need to be taken into consideration when choosing a post production company to suit your needs.
What Does a Post House Cost?
It's going to be one of the main factors in your decision. Sometimes it is necessary to work out a buy-out with your chosen post house to keep within budget, or negotiate some flexibility on overages.
Concerns over delivering to schedule are only deepened when worrying about spiralling costs in the post production portion of your programme. Many Production Managers have had the unpleasant task of looking down the back of the sofa to pay the extra costs a project can run up in post.
Location and Opening Times
You're going to spend a lot of time there so, if possible, you're better off picking a company that's close by and avoiding the time and expense of travel and accommodation. If the offline edit is going to begin while the shoot is still happening, bear that in mind too.
Also, consider what their opening times are. Will they fit in with your schedule or ways of working? There's no point expecting to burn the midnight oil over an edit if the post house closes the doors and boots out the tech staff at 6pm.
It's also worth investigating the catering facilities onsite. You can guarantee your team will be working through their lunches, so at least make sure they have access to nice food!
What Facilities does the Post Production Company Have?
From a purely technical point of view, it makes little aesthetic difference whether you use Final Cut Pro, Avid Media Composer, Adobe Premiere or any other system for the offline edit. However, each has its strengths and weaknesses and it will come down to personal preference and experience as much as anything. If your editor is used to one system, that's what they will want to use so its always worth sitting down with prospective Post Houses to discuss your options.
Then you need to consider what you'll need when you reach the online edit. For some projects, this can be done on the same machine as the offline, simply conforming the high res version and adding the titles. However, in other projects you'll need to think about things like colour correction to create a particular visual style. Will you need visual effects? This is a specialist field and you need to consider whether you want this all done under one roof or are happy to work with more than one team.
Finally, think about sound. Will you need to add a voice over? Are you going to be shooting in settings that make it likely a sound-dub will be needed? If your post production company doesn't have recording facilities onsite, consider whether trips back and forth to a separate studio will add substantial cost and time delays.
Scalability and Flexibility
Can they scale up to meet the demands of your production? If it's a big one with a lot of footage that will need to be edited quickly, can they provide you with the extra facilities or time in the suite that you might need? Also consider the technical support your team may need. Can the people onsite be trusted to solve the toughest challenges video production can throw at you?
Existing Relationships
At the end of the day, the equipment is simply the tool. What matters is who is using it. If you've been around for a while, chances are you'll already have a favoured post house that you've used on projects in the past. You know how they work, they know how you work and they'll be more likely to help out when something unexpected arises. You'll have confidence in their abilities and know where their key skills lie.
An existing good relationship with a Facilities Manager, someone who already knows you and appreciates your custom is valuable and can be the key to getting that flexibility. It's them who'll be able to find the extra couple of hours' time in a suite for those sudden unexpected changes, even though they are fully booked. They may also have relationships with other houses so can organise for something they can't do in-house to be done by someone they know and trust.
Reputations
If you don't know anyone or want to change then it can just be a simple case of asking around. The reputations of the best post houses will go before them and many of your colleagues and connections will have their favourites they're happy to recommend.
